Block

#18,910,791
Block Number
18,910,791 @ 06/23/2024, 10:44:00
Status
Finalizing
ID
0x01208e470ede1a6bdb530da9458192b9e3fafd6299e6248d28c1d8803026bb37
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
159,301,717 (+14)
Rewards
0.00 VTHO